Neighbors Greet Neighbors During National Night Out

The nationwide annual event brings together community members and public service staff in Hermosa Beach.

Neighbors and neighborhoods came alive in Hermosa Beach Tuesday night as the city's volunteer-led Neighborhood Watch and city service and safety staff participated in National Night Out.

The evening included a rotation of safety vehicles that visited neighborhoods in the city, said Tracy Hopkins of Neighborhood Watch.

In its 30th year, National Night Out brought together people in more than 15,700 communities consisting of 37.5 million people from all 50 states, U.S. territories, Canadian cities and military bases around the world. The mission of the event is to fight crime and prevent drug use.
